## Formula sandbox tuning

User-supplied formulas in Gridmoor execute inside a restricted interpreter with hard ceilings on time, memory, and call depth. Reviewers should confirm any change to these ceilings is justified in the PR description, since raising them widens the abuse surface. Defaults were chosen from production traces. The current limits are as follows.

limits module of tafog-fawip:
WEIGHTS = {
    "julix": 57,
    "lamys": 992,
    "kasvan": 209,
    "quenok": 750,
    "alddor": 259,
    "oliath": 1009,
    "wenix": 815,
}

Ticket #4417 — Missed pick-up, sample shipment to Brellan Labs

Heads up, folks at the Norwick receiving dock: the courier never showed yesterday for the chilled sample crate bound for Brellan Labs, so the whole batch from the Verdane trial is still sitting in our cold room. We've rebooked for tomorrow morning and Marla will have everything repacked with fresh ice bricks by 8am. Please flag the driver down personally — don't let them leave without signing. Confidential hand-over instruction for the courier follows below.

dispatch memo: the eliok quenok courier leaves the sorael aldath belion tammir casix gileth queniel jorath ledger at gate 9299 under passcode 897989

Handover for the Larkspur public API review. Pagination is cursor-based; cursors are signed and expire after one hour, which prevents enumeration of deleted records. Please verify the page-size cap cannot be overridden via header injection — that was the v2 incident. Rate limits apply per token. The relevant production configuration values are reproduced below.

config for kafof-bawef:
holath:
  log_level: debug
  metrics_host: metrics.holath.qorvelsys.internal
  pin: 2191
  pool_size: 32

09:14 — The nightly cleanup job on Cartmere's orders table began hard-deleting rows flagged deleted_at, bypassing the soft-delete retention window. A migration the prior week dropped the guard clause. Roughly 3,100 rows were removed early; all were recoverable from the replica snapshot. Restore completed 11:02. Maintainers: the guard is now enforced at the trigger level. The migration build responsible is identified by the token below.

session token of tajef-bageg = htk21_5d90d574934f3ccae6437